<分区>
到目前为止,我已经成功下载并安装了 SDK 及其在我的 PATH 中。现在的问题是我无法运行“android update sdk”,因为它希望连接到显示器并且我通过 ssh 连接到远程 headless (headless)服务器(它是一个构建服务器,所以没有桌面环境)。 android 工具是否有命令行选项告诉它在没有 X 的情况下运行?
<分区>
到目前为止,我已经成功下载并安装了 SDK 及其在我的 PATH 中。现在的问题是我无法运行“android update sdk”,因为它希望连接到显示器并且我通过 ssh 连接到远程 headless (headless)服务器(它是一个构建服务器,所以没有桌面环境)。 android 工具是否有命令行选项告诉它在没有 X 的情况下运行?
最佳答案
更新有一个 --no-ui
标志。
典型的 Linux 设置:
cd android-sdk-linux_86/tools
./android update sdk -u
这将 headless (headless)地运行它。注意,-u
和 --no-ui
是同一个标志
关于android - 如何在 headless (headless)服务器上从命令行设置 Android sdk?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2684296/
相关文章:
Android 5.0 - 实现 Google Play 电影 Material 设计 "My movies"屏幕
ios - 我到底应该在哪里调用 [FBSettings publishInstall :appId]
javascript - 在使用 cmake 打包成 zip 之前缩小 CSS 和 Javascripts 文件
android - SSLHandshakeException 云端点客户端库
android - 从 nativescript 调用 android 方法(sdk、aar 或 jar)
ios - 在Xcode中,缺少较旧的iOS SDK-仅适用于预先存在的项目
java - 如何在 Linux 中为我的 Java 项目创建 Windows 安装程序?
sql-server - 您建议使用什么用户帐户在开发环境中运行 SQL Server Express 2008 服务?